Agora Outlook option selling strategy

Agora Outlook is a company started by Ken Davidson. They feature a strategy of option selling, using outright selling and credit spreads on the cash indices. It is subscription-based.

The returns shown on their website are market crushing. Since 1990, the lowest return has been 48% in the 'regular trades' system, which occurred in 1998. Every other year has been higher than that, with several years returning over 100%, and the average return is 134%!!! The best part is that the system has been working since 1990. These are not hypothetical backtested returns!

Unfortunately, the site does not give details on drawdowns or the leverage used. Usually, option selling strategies have a high win % and high leverage, which means that every once in a while they get whacked pretty good.

Agora probably uses a sophisticated timing model to enter into trades. The cost is not too bad, $100 per month or $1000 per year (for retail investors). They donate most of the subscription proceeds to charity, which means that Agora probably makes more money trading than they do selling the subscription.

This strategy would not be for risk-averse or inexperienced traders, due to the leverage involved.
